import bsp; typedef path3[] shape; shape operator *(transform3 T, shape p){ shape os; for(path3 g:p) os.push(T*g); return os; } path3 path(triple[] T){ path3 P; for(triple i:T) P=P--i; return P; } void addshapes(face[] F, shape[] shp, pen drawpen=currentpen, pen fillpen=white) { for(int i=0; i < shp.length; ++i) for(int j=0; j < shp[i].length; ++j) { path3 g=shp[i][j]; picture pic=F.push(g); filldraw(pic, project(g), fillpen, drawpen); // filldraw(pic, g, currentlight.intensity(F[F.length-1].point)*fillpen, drawpen); } } shape cylinder(real R=1, real H=1, int n=18){ shape Cyl; triple[] CTop; triple[] CBot; for(int i=0; i <= n; ++i) CBot.push((R*cos(2pi*i/n), R*sin(2pi*i/n), 0)); CTop = CBot+(0, 0, H); for(int i=0; i < n; ++i) Cyl.push(CBot[i]--CBot[i+1]--CTop[i+1]--CTop[i]--cycle); path3 P=path(CBot)--cycle; Cyl.push(P); Cyl.push(shift(H*Z)*P); return Cyl; } shape rightslab(real x=1, real y=1, real z=1){ shape slab; slab[0] = (0, 0, 0)--(1, 0, 0)--(1, 1, 0)--(0, 1, 0)--cycle; slab[1] = (0, 0, 0)--(1, 0, 0)--(1, 0, 1)--(0, 0, 1)--cycle; slab[2] = (1, 0, 0)--(1, 1, 0)--(1, 1, 1)--(1, 0, 1)--cycle; slab[3] = (1, 1, 0)--(0, 1, 0)--(0, 1, 1)--(1, 1, 1)--cycle; slab[4] = (0, 1, 0)--(0, 0, 0)--(0, 0, 1)--(0, 1, 1)--cycle; slab[5] = (0, 0, 1)--(1, 0, 1)--(1, 1, 1)--(0, 1, 1)--cycle; return scale(x, y, z)*slab; } size(10cm, 0); triple cam=(1600, 200, 150); //currentprojection=orthographic(1600, 800, 400); currentprojection=perspective(cam); //Far away! currentlight=rotate(-45, Z)*(cam+(0, 0, 1000)); real Blen = 180; real Bwdt = 30; real Bhgt = 3; real Clen = 130; real Cwdt = 50; real Chgt = 50; real cylr = 7.5; real cylh = 37.0 ; shape slab1 = shift(-Bwdt/2*Y-Bhgt/2*Z+Clen/2*X)*rightslab(Blen, Bwdt, Bhgt); shape slab2 = shift(-Cwdt/2*Y-Chgt/2*Z-Clen/2*X)*rightslab(Clen, Cwdt, Chgt); shape cyl1 = shift((Blen+Clen/2-2*cylr)*X-(cylh/2)*Z)*cylinder(R=cylr, H=cylh); shape[] group1={slab1}; shape[] group2={slab2}; shape[] group3={cyl1}; face[] faces; addshapes(faces, group1, drawpen=linewidth(0.25bp), fillpen=opacity(0.35)+red); addshapes(faces, group2, drawpen=linewidth(0.25bp), fillpen=opacity(0.5)+lightblue); addshapes(faces, group3, drawpen=linewidth(0.25bp), fillpen=opacity(0.5)+lightyellow); add(faces); shipout(format="pdf", bbox(3mm, white));
